Why choose a Black Cohosh Herbal Collection?

Black cohosh is a widely used herbal option for people seeking non-hormonal approaches to manage menopausal symptoms such as hot flashes and night sweats. A Black Cohosh Herbal Collection typically includes capsules, tinctures, blended formulas and drink mixes that combine black cohosh with complementary herbs and nutrients. Key selection criteria: what to compare and why

When buying from a Black Cohosh Herbal Collection, focus on criteria that affect safety, quality and performance. Use this checklist while shopping.

  • Formulation and fit:Do you prefer capsules, a tincture, a powdered drink or a comprehensive multivitamin blend? Fit affects absorption, convenience and how quickly you might notice changes.
  • Standardisation and potency:Look for standardised extracts or clear dose information so you know how much extract or active constituents you’re taking per serving.
  • Complementary ingredients:Many products pair black cohosh with vitex, ashwagandha, vitamins or botanicals. Check compatibility with your symptoms and other supplements you take.
  • Quality and source:Prefer brands that disclose origin, third-party testing,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P) or lab certificates to support claims about purity and contaminants.
  • Safety and interactions:Verify safety guidance, contraindications and whether the product is suitable if you have a hormone-sensitive condition - seek pharmacist or GP advice when needed.
  • Performance expectations:Understand realistic timelines for effect (weeks rather than days for many herbal supplements) and what outcomes the product targets - symptom relief, mood, sleep or general wellbeing.
  • Value and serving size:Compare capsules per day, tincture drops per serving or scoop sizes for drinks to assess how long a pack will last and whether it suits your routine.
  • Dietary and lifestyle fit:Vegan, vegetarian, alcohol-free tinctures, sugar-free drink mixes and allergen declarations matter for everyday compatibility.

Material and technology science: how and why black cohosh may help

Black cohosh (Actaea racemosa) is a herb traditionally used for menopausal support. Modern supplement formulations vary in extraction methods-water, ethanol or hydroalcoholic extracts-and these affect which constituents are present. While black cohosh doesn’t contain oestrogen, research suggests it may interact with neurotransmitter pathways involved in temperature regulation and mood.

Key technical points buyers should know:

  • Extract type:Hydroalcoholic extracts often concentrate different compounds than aqueous extracts; manufacturers should state the extraction solvent and standardisation.
  • Standardised extracts:Products that state a standardised content (for example specific marker compounds) give a more predictable dose. This helps with performance consistency between batches.
  • Delivery form:Soft gels and capsules can use oil-based carriers to improve absorption of fat-soluble compounds; tinctures deliver concentrated extracts and can be easier to titrate.
  • Synergy with co-ingredients:Herbs like vitex and adaptogens such as ashwagandha are often combined to support hormonal balance, mood and stress resilience. Vitamin D, B vitamins and magnesium are commonly added to target sleep and energy.

Safety warnings and usage limits

Safety is paramount when selecting herbal supplements. The following points reflect current best-practice consumer guidance rather than clinical advice. Always consult a healthcare professional for personal medical conditions or if taking medications.

  • Pregnancy and breastfeeding:Avoid black cohosh during pregnancy and breastfeeding unless advised by your clinician; many manufacturers recommend caution.
  • Liver safety:There have been rare reports of liver adverse events with black cohosh. Choose products with transparent testing and stop use if you experience jaundice, dark urine or persistent abdominal pain, and seek medical advice.
  • Interactions:Black cohosh may interact with hormone therapies or medications metabolised by certain liver enzymes. Discuss potential interactions with a pharmacist or GP.
  • Age and chronic conditions:Older adults and people with chronic liver, kidney or cardiovascular conditions should check suitability with a clinician before starting supplements.
  • Dose limits:Follow manufacturer instructions. Typical trial periods are 6-12 weeks to assess effect; for long-term use, seek medical review.

Maintenance and care checklist

Proper storage and routine checks prolong product life and maintain performance.

  • Store capsules and tinctures in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ight.
  • Check expiry dates and batch numbers; reputable brands provide batch testing details or certificates of analysis on request.
  • Keep a symptom diary for 4-12 weeks to track any improvements or side effects and to evaluate performance against product claims.
  • Rotate or reassess supplements if you change other medications or health conditions-compatibility can change over time.

How to trial safely and measure results

Trialling a product methodically helps you judge real-world performance and fit.

  1. Start with the lowest recommended dose for one week to check tolerance.
  2. Use a simple symptom diary logging hot flashes, night sweats, sleep quality and mood at least three times weekly.
  3. Assess after 6-12 weeks-many herbal supplements need several weeks to show benefit.
  4. If you notice adverse symptoms, discontinue and consult a healthcare professional immediately.

FAQ

How long before I can expect to see benefits?

Most people evaluate herbal supplements over 6-12 weeks. Some may notice changes earlier in sleep or mood; relief for hot flashes can take several weeks. Keep a symptom diary to judge individual response.

Are black cohosh products safe to use with other supplements?

Many people combine black cohosh with vitamins and adaptogens, but interactions are possible. Check labels for overlapping ingredients and consult a pharmacist if you take prescription medicines or have liver conditions.

Which form is best for travelling or busy routines?

Capsules and sachet-style drink mixes are easiest for travel. Tinctures are compact but subject to liquid restrictions on flights; sealed soft gels are generally most practical for day-to-day use.

Where can I find transparent product testing information?

Look on the product page for certificates of analysis, batch numbers and manufacturing standards. Reputable retailers include these details in the product description or make them available on request.
